Fresh Guacamole recipe



This recipe is from our food and recipe blog here.

So low in carbs, not worth worrying about, serves two, and just tastes so good.
Avocados are one of the healthiest foods on the planet. 

Ingredients

2 medium sized avocados scrape out the flesh and chop.
I medium sized tomato finely chopped remove seeds
I heaped tablespoon of finely chopped green Jalapeno peppers 
I tablespoon of finely chopped white onion
One teaspoon of extra virgin olive oil
The juice from a medium sized lime
Salt and black pepper to taste

Method

Mix all the ingredients in a pyrex jug or bowl and serve, how easy is that.
